Set along the Merrimack River and just minutes away from the New Hampshire-Massachusetts border, Newburyport is a colorful city full of character and charm. Its proximity to the ocean and location along the riverfront means there’s always something to do, if not a spectacular view to enjoy. Explore the picturesque downtown area and all the bars and restaurants on offer. Enjoy dinner along the water at Michael’s Harborside or bar-hop along Merrimac St.

Natural beauty is all around Newburyport. Plum Island and the beach are part of the city, and just minutes away along the coast. Maudslay State Park and a slew of other green spaces are popular spots in the warmer months too.

There’s a variety of apartment offerings along the water or just steps from it, and should you need to venture inland, the I-95 or US 1 will ferry you where you need to go.

What do Walkability, Transit, Drivability, and Bikeability mean? Walkability measures the walking distance to day-to-day needs. Transit measures access to public transportation. Drivability measures congestion, parking availability, and access to major roads. Bikeability measures the suitability for cycling. How It Works
